PR Urges Umno-BN to Promise to Respect the Process of Democracy throughout the GE-13 Campaign Period

SHAH ALAM, 4 Apr: Pakatan Rakyat (PR) has called all parties, especially Umno-BN to jointly abide by proper campaign ethics and to respect the process of democracy through the 13th General Elections (GE-13) campaign period.

Opposition Leader, Datuk Seri Anwar Ibrahim said that if all parties comply with election standards prescribed, security and peace in the country can be defended and irresponsible practices will be overcome.

In fact, he said, the transition of government will also be guaranteed to happen peacefully if PR wins the GE-13.

“Pakatan Rakyat has the confidence that the security forces will act professionally and fairly in ensuring public order and security throughout the campaign period.

“This is in tandem with the duties and responsibilities entrusted upon them by the Federal Constitution to protect the democratic process and to ensure that the people have the freedom to choose the government of their choice,” he said in a media statement.

He also called upon all Malaysians to use this golden opportunity to elect a new government that is not only capable of developing the country, but is also determined to cleanse the country from corruption and abuse of power.

He said that he is confident that the people will elect a government that acts fairly in all matters across all levels of society.

In fact, he once again extended an invitation to the Prime Minister, Datuk Seri Najib Tun Razak, to engage in a debate to enable the people to make the right choice before choosing a new government.

“Throughout the 12th Parliament, Pakatan Rakyat has presented obvious choices for the people with the offer of a comprehensive blueprint for economic, political and social reforms.

“In fact, all four states administered by the Pakatan Rakyat Government also have records to be proud of in terms of economic and social progress, accountability and transparency.

“We believe that the people are able to assess the positive changes that have and will be brought by Pakatan Rakyat,” he added.
